Введение к работе
Актуальность темы. В настоящее время качество программных средств вычислительной техники (ПС ВТ) остается наиболее узким местом в улучшении потребительских свойств вычислительных систем. Это приводит к большим затратам на поддержание ПС ВТ в работоспособном состоянии.
В данной работе исследование проблемы качества охватывает инструментально-технологическое обеспечение качества прикладных программ для решения экономических задач на этапах разработки. Это задачи учета и контроля, в основе которых лежат типовые процессы обработки информационных массивов (сортироЕка. слияние, уплотнение, редактирование и другие). т. е. задачи, решаемые рядом подсистем АСУП с помощью программ обработки данных (ПОД).
В настоящее время проблема проектирования и проблема качества программ решаются обособленно друг от друга. Применяемые методы проектирования практически инвариантны к заданным показателям качества разрабатываемой программы.
В соответствии с этим целью диссертации является повышение эффективности процесса разработки программных средств с заданным уровнем качества.
Для достижения поставленной цели в работе сформулирована научная задача: разработать методику и инструментальные программные средства, обеспечивающие получение программы обработки данных с заданными показателями качества.
Для решения этой задачи сформулированы две подзадачи:
разработать методику оценки показателей качества программ обработки данных:
разработать метод проектирования, обеспечивающий достижение заданного уровня качества программ обработки данных.
Сформулированные подзадачи по сути являются прямой и обратной задачами квалпметрии.
Ha^i]aj_jiOBH3Hajic^ej.qEMira. На защиту выносятса следующие результаты:
-' методика- оценки уровня качества программ на базе автоматизированных методов оценки, включая комплекс основных показателей качества программ обработки данных:
- метод проектирования программ обработки данных _с
заданными псказателлын качестга:
- метод синтеза программ обработки данных с учетом заданных показателей.
Практическая значимость работы состоит в том. что результаты проведенных исследований были положены в основу создания программных средств, обеспечивающих разработку автоматизированных систем управления предприятием:
Т-ЫОДА - Комплекс программ, обеспечивающих поддержку процесса конструирования программ систем обработки данных в диалоговом режиме из типовых процедур;
САПР ПО СОД - Система автоматизированного проектирования программного обеспечения для задач обработки данных в АСУП (номер ГОС. per. 50870001593);
ШОК - Программное средство информационно-методической поддержки оценки качества программного обеспечения (номер гос. per. 50900000435).
Результаты работы были использованы при разработке "Методики оценки показателей качества ПС с использованием инструментальных средств" и "Методики формирования единичных показателей и определения базовых значений показателей качества ПС", которые внедрены в Государственном испытательном сертификационном центре ПС ВТ.
Апробация результатов исследований. Основные результаты диссертационной работы докладывались и обсуждались на 14 конференциях, совещаниях и семинарах:
1. 2 и 3-й Международных научно-технических конференциях "Программное обеспечение ЭВМ" (Калинин, июль 1984, ноябрь 1987, ноябрь 1990);
Всесоюзной научно-технической конференцію "Программные средства как продукція производственно-технического назначения" (Калинин, ноябрь 1985):
Всесоюзном научно-техническом семинаре "Экономика, организация и технология разработки и сопровождения программных средств" (Калинин, апрель 1986);
Всесоюзной научной конференции "Проблемы совершенствования синтеза, тестирования и верификации программ" (Рига, ноябрь 1906);
Советско-польском семинаре по компьютерной поддержке проектдах работ (Вроцлав, ПНР. май 1987);
Всесоюзном совещании "Программное обеспечение новой ин-
формац;:ошюй технологии" (Калинин, ноябрь 1989):
Всесоюзном семинаре "Качество программных средств" (Ка
линин, март 1390); .
Конференции "Методы и средства повышения эффективности и качества программных систем" (Севастополь, апрель 1990);
Международной конференции "SOFTOOL USSR" (Москва, октябрь 1990);
Семинаре-совещании "Управление качеством программных средств вычислительной техники" (Севастополь, октябрь 1990);
2-м Всесоюзном семинаре "Управление качеством ПС ВТ" (Дагомыс, ноябрь 1990):
Международном семинаре "Качество программного обеспечения" (Санкт-Петербург, октябрь 1992).
Публикации. По теме диссертации опубликованы 24 печатные работы объемом около 7 печатных листов.
Структура работы. Диссертация состоит ив введения, четырех глав, заключения, списка литературы и приложения. Обьем основной части работы составляет 134 страницы, включая 29 рисунков и 5 таблиц. Список литературы содержит 137 библиографических наименований. Приложение _ занимает 7 страниц. Общий обьем работы - 157 страниц.